Fast-unto-death for the second day
Shirley Wijesinghe
The fast-unto-death campaign organized by the National Freedom Front
with the support of other patriotic groups to press UN General Secretary
Ban Ki- moon to dissolve the UN special advisory panel was staged
opposite the Colombo UN Office by NFF Chairman Wimal Weerawansa
yesterday morning for the second day after the chanting of Pirith by the
Mahasanga.

Addressing the gathering before launching the protest campaign,
Weerawansa said he will not stop his fast-unto -death campaign until the
advisory panel is dissolve.
Weerawansa appealed to International Powers specially China and
Russia to impose pressure on Ban Ki-moon to dissolve the special
advisory panel appointed by him at his own whim.
He said he will continue the protest campaign overpowering any type
of rival challenges imposed on him.
National Patriotic Movement President Gunadasa Amarasekera said the
appointment of the special advisory panel is clearly violating the UN
procedures and unethical. |
